BundleSync: Atomic Cloud Storage for Multi-File Project Directories
Standard cloud providers (like iCloud and Google Drive) often fail to treat multi-file project directories as atomic units, leading to file corruption, sync conflicts, and 'invalid project' errors for writers moving between desktop and mobile devices.

Webhook Deduplication Gateway
When third-party services retry webhooks (often due to slow processing), automation workflows trigger multiple times. This causes duplicate database entries, redundant API calls, and inconsistent data. Current workarounds require setting up external infrastructure (SQL/Redis) for every workflow.

FlowAudit: Observability and Health Monitoring for Low-Code Automations
Low-code platforms often lack deep observability, leading to 'silent failures' where a workflow runs without error but produces empty or incorrect output. Users struggle with fragmented logs, manual triage of failures, and the difficulty of scoping how long a fix will take (e.g., is it a 5-minute auth fix or a 3-hour logic redesign?).
